Rhode Island Executive Office of Helath and Human Services announced that overdose deaths are at a decline.
Officials said the newly released data from Rhode Island Department of Helath Substance Use Epidemiology Program show that 329 people died from accidental overdose in 2024, which is an 18% decrease compared to 2023.
“This is a sign of hope,” said Gov. Dan McKee. “We know there is still much work ahead, but the steps we are taking are saving lives. We must keep engaging, listening, and providing support to individuals, families, and communities. We will stay vigilant to prevent further loss of lives.”…
